> > I'm running python 3.2a for fun and tried to port pyglet to it. This
> > is what i did:
> > 1) hg clonehttps://pyglet.googlecode.com/hg/pyglet
> > 2) cd pyglet
> > 3) 2to3 -w -n pyglet
> > 4) 2to3 -w -n examples
> > 5) python setup.py install
>
> > All this seemed to go splendidly.
